The Sales Lead Development Specialist is responsible for qualifying marketing-generated leads and ultimately converting prospects into sales-ready business-to-business leads. You will engage with prospects through outbound calls, emails and other communication channels, presenting Planar products and services while building strong relationships to drive sales growth.

What you'll do:

  • Prospect and qualify leads using a variety of communication techniques. Continuously nurture and follow-up with leads, addressing inquiries and providing necessary information to move prospects through the sales pipeline
  • Utilize Salesforce to track and manage prospect interactions, activities and progress toward converting leads to opportunities
  • Engage with prospects through website live chat, addressing questions and providing information about products and services to quickly move prospects into the sales pipeline
  • Work closely with Regional Account Mangers and Vertical Business Development Teams to hand-off qualified leads for project follow-up
  • Work with Marketing to develop lead generation campaigns
  • Report weekly lead qualification results and objectives
  • Support Salesforce data integrity projects as needed

Benefits

All benefits start on first day of employment

  • 75% employer-paid medical for employee. Family coverage also included.
  • 100% employer paid dental, and vision for employee and dependents
  • 100% employer paid long-term, short-term disability, and life insurance policy
  • 401k Match, if you’re contributing 5% we match 4%. 100% vested immediately.
  • 10 paid holidays
  • Starting at 15 days paid PTO (inclusive of sick and vacation time) annually
  • Employee Assistance Program (EAP)
  • Flexible Spending Account (FSA)
